MLC vs. North Greenville University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, MLC or North Greenville University?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).

  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Martin Luther College than North Greenville University ($18,974 vs. $21,346).
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Martin Luther College are 33.3% lower than at North Greenville University ($7,900 vs. $11,850).
  • North Greenville University is 42.4% more expensive for in-state tuition than MLC (about $7,680 more per year; $25,800.00 vs. $18,120.00).
  • Out-of-state tuition is 42.4% higher at North Greenville University than at Martin Luther College (about $7,680 more per year; $25,800.00 vs. $18,120.00).
  • The same share of students receive grant aid at Martin Luther College as at North Greenville University (100% vs. 100%).
  • The average total grant financial aid received by North Greenville University students is 98.2% larger than aid received by Martin Luther College students ($20,368 vs. $10,276).

MLC vs. North Greenville University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

How do outcomes compare for MLC and North Greenville University?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).

  • Martin Luther College's six-year graduation rate (73%) is higher than North Greenville University's (46%).
  • Graduates from Martin Luther College earn a median of about $4,500 more per year than North Greenville University graduates about ten years after starting college ($38,000 vs. $33,500),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
  • Among federal student loan borrowers, North Greenville University graduates have a $1,625 lower median loan debt than MLC graduates ($21,500 vs. $23,125).
  • Among borrowers, North Greenville University graduates have an estimated $17 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than MLC graduates ($222 vs. $239).
  • More MLC gra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former North Greenville University students, three years after graduation. (89% vs. 62%)
